A DARK GREEN STONE BLADE NEOLITHIC PERIOD, CIRCA 2500-2000 BC The blade is convex on both faces and tapers towards the curved cutting edge with a rounded upper corner above the hafting hole drilled from one side. The stone is of an even deep pine-green colour. 13 5/8 in. (34.6 cm.) long, box Provenance Acquired in Hong Kong prior to 1999
